Postal code 59718 is used by homes and businesses in and around Bozeman, Montana, and covers 621.7 square kilometers. About 23.4 square kilometers of this postal code falls within a USDA exclusion zone. By percentage, about 3.8% of zip code area 59718 is ineligible for rural development USDA home loans.

Bozeman is a city in southwestern Montana, located in the Gallatin County. Bozeman has a population of around 48,532 people. It is a college town, as it is home to Montana State University, which was established in 1893. The city has a strong economy, with its primary industries being healthcare, education, and technology. Bozeman also serves as a gateway to Yellowstone National Park, which is located around 90 miles south of the city. The city offers many recreational opportunities, including hiking, skiing, and fishing. It has a vibrant arts and culture scene, with various galleries, museums, and performing arts centers. Overall, Bozeman is known for its beautiful natural surroundings, thriving economy, and high quality of life.
